Governors of the U.S.

Most states hold elections for governor on an alternating cycle with Presidential elections: there are 36 statehouses on the block in the off-cycle (see 2006) and 11 statehouses on the block in the presidential cycle. The other three are elected in odd-years.

In the 2008 election, there are two Democratic governors and one Republican governor not seeking another term.

  1. DE - Minner (D) not seeking another term
  2. IN - Daniels (R) seeking second term
  3. MT - Schweitzer (D) seeking second term
  4. MO - Blunt (R) not seeking another term
  5. NH - Lynch (D) seeking second term
  6. NC - Easley (D) not seeking another term
  7. ND - Hoeven (R) seeking second term
  8. UT - Huntsman (R) seeking second term
  9. VT - Douglas (R) seeking second term
  10. WA - Gregoire (D) seeking second term
  11. WV - Manchin (D) seeking second term
